Paul, the creator of EverWood Studio, who is known for exclusive steampunk furniture design using industrial material, has come-up with a coffee table design which is unique. Dubbed as Cyberpunk Coffee table, since it is made from laptop parts, the table is ideal for any geeky home setup.

This 63×35 cm wide and 43 cm tall table is made from oak wood and salvaged parts of his first laptop, a Toshiba Satellite 300CDS. Firstly, he made the supporting frame of the table and then fitted all the laptop parts inside it. To add to the flair, he installed LED lights, so that the table looks funky during the evening and night time. To power the LED lights, he has added an AA battery-powered unit on the back side of this coffee table.

Paul is an artist with a technical background who likes to fuse art with technology has setup his shop in Romania. This coffee table in particular, can be considered as one of his most geeky creation when it comes to industrial furniture design for home décor. Thankfully, Paul is selling the coffee table on Etsy for SGD 996.54 a-piece.
